## 3.1.0 — Changed defaults

GatePulse turnstile counters now aggregate entry events in 5-second windows instead of 30, improving accuracy during surge periods at Ashbourne Arena. The stale-sensor timeout was also reduced, so expect more frequent (but faster-clearing) sensor alerts. Please review alert thresholds accordingly. For reference, the full set of new default values follows.

settings of fajop-fahap:
[holeth]
port = 9300
team = juleth
host = holeth.tolvaqsoft.example
region = south-4
access_code = ac_4bcdf6
timeout_ms = 500

Account Recovery — Gridwright Crossword Generator. Puzzle authors locked out mid-publication lose their draft grids after 48 hours, so treat these recoveries as time-sensitive. Verify the author owns the affected puzzle series by checking the generation log for their seed history, then suspend the autosave purge before proceeding. Restore the session from the most recent checkpoint and confirm the grid renders correctly. Complete the account restoration by entering the passphrase provided below.

vault phrase of yagag-kadup = belael-druius-rusax-kelox

Changelog — Brisklet 2.4.0: We renamed `WARM_POOL_HINT` to `COLDSTART_PREWARM`. Same behavior, clearer name — it controls how many handler instances Brisklet keeps warm so your plugin's serverless entrypoints don't eat a multi-second cold start on first invoke. The old name still works until 3.0 but logs a deprecation warning, so plugin authors should migrate their env files now. After setting the new flag, your env file also needs the prewarm coordinator token, which goes on the next line.

sealed setting: ARCHIVE_KEY3=8d0

Handover note — Crumbwheel order cutoffs.

Welcome aboard. The bakery cutoff rule in Crumbwheel closes same-day orders at 14:00 local to each storefront, not UTC — this has bitten us twice. Holiday overrides live in the calendar service and take precedence silently, so always check there first when a cutoff looks wrong. To unlock the calendar service's admin console after a restart, enter the recovery passphrase below.

vault phrase of bagap-bahaf = silion-pelox-sorox-casdor-quenwyn-fraax-eliox-praael-kelion-quenvan-kasox-rusael-norius-belvan